Purple Blotch Disease in Onion Crops: Symptoms and Control Measures
Onion is an important cash crop for farmers, cultivated in both the Rabi and Kharif seasons. However, due to favorable weather conditions, various diseases can affect onion crops, with purple blotch disease being a major threat. This disease affects both the yield and quality of the crop, causing significant losses for farmers.
Purple blotch disease affects the leaves and stems of the onion plant, halting plant growth and reducing crop production. Effective management of this disease is essential to ensure good onion yield.
How Does the Disease Spread?
This disease primarily spreads through wind, infected plant residues, and moisture. High humidity (80-90%), temperatures between 18-25°C, rainfall, or excessive irrigation speed up the spread of the disease.
Management of Purple Blotch Disease:
1. Adopt Crop Rotation:
Growing onions in rotation with other crops can reduce the impact of this disease.
2. Maintain Field Hygiene:
Remove infected plant residues from the field, as they are the main source of disease spread.
3. Manage Drainage:
Ensure there is no waterlogging in the field, as excessive moisture promotes disease development.
4. Use Balanced Fertilizers:
Use a balanced amount of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potash. Excess nitrogen can exacerbate the disease.
5. Choose Resistant Varieties
Opt for onion varieties that are disease-resistant, to minimize crop damage.

Irrigation Management for Crop Protection:
Use drip irrigation in the morning for onion crops, which helps prevent excessive moisture and reduces the likelihood of disease development.
